G4S partners with Transport for NSW to reduce road fatalities. Road safety cameras are a proven and effective way to get drivers to slow down and ultimately, save lives. Revenue from fines is directed to the Community Road Safety Fund to support priority road safety programs with most reinvested in infrastructure safety upgrades on roads in NSW.
ABOUT THE ROLE
Our Mobile Speed Camera Operators are skilled and trained to work alone in an enforcement vehicle that links to a control centre. It is a physical role with unusual hours and early and late starts. They perform a risk assessment and take photos of each site prior to each session, communicate with a control room to align and test cameras, and are trained to respond to angry and aggressive behavior.

REMUNERATION
Mobile Speed Camera Operators are paid $26.18 an hour for ordinary hours. The penalty rates are $31.42 an hour for night shifts, $31.42 an hour on Saturday's, $39.27 an hour on Sunday's, and $39.27 - $52.36 an hour for overtime.
